4. Husband Reverend Dr. A. W. Watkins, Jr. was married to Mrs. Ethel L. Curry Watkins for over 50 glorious years.
5. Father Reverend Watkins was the proud father of ten children and several loving grandchildren.

7. Pastor Continued For 21 years, Rev. Watkins served as pastor for three churches. He preached at Mobile Heights Baptist Church the first through the third Sunday; and the fourth Sunday, he would preach at Daniel Baptist Church in Tuskegee; on the first and third Sunday in the afternoons he would preach at Helicon Missionary Baptist Church in Grady.
8. Dedicated Employee In 1967, Rev. Watkins was hired to work for Alabama Farm Bureau to perform domestic duties. He was a full-time employee, dedicated family man and pastor of three churches. He worked for ALFA for 32 years before retiring.

10. Honorary Doctor In 1987, Rev. A. W. Watkins, Jr. was presented with an Honorary Doctoral degree from Selma University, Selma, Alabama.
11. Historian Prior to his demise, Reverend Dr. A.W. Watkins, Jr. was the oldest African American pastor serving as Shepherd of a church in the City of Montgomery. He worked tirelessly spreading the word in the effort to save souls. 14. The Reverend Dr. A. W. Watkins Scholarship Fund, Inc. is a non-profit organization with the mission of supporting education. This organization will provide financial aid to high school graduates from Central Alabama and juniors and seniors enrolled in the College of Bible and Pastoral Ministry at Selma University, Alabama. Selma University is where Rev. Dr. A. W. Watkins, Jr. earned his Honorary Doctoral Degree. The Reverend Dr. A. W. Watkins Scholarship Fund, Inc. was incorporated in the State of Alabama on December 30, 2003 and obtained its federal tax exemption status on May 19, 2004. return to: www. revdrawwatkins .com
